TÉLÉCHARGER PYTHON 3.4.2 GRATUITEMENT

Ce code affichera la sortie suivante:. Il existe même des langages qui formalise la construction de programmes oriéntés objets, par exemple le langage UML. La plupart de ces modules sont déjà installés dans les versions standards de Python. Les arguments entre crochets sont optionnels. Lignes 10 et Par exemple variable de type entier sera équivalent à un objet de type entier.

Nom: python 3.4.2
Format: Fichier D’archive
Système d’exploitation: Windows, Mac, Android, iOS
Licence: Usage Personnel Seulement
Taille: 44.70 MBytes

Le self est également nécessaire pour appeler une méthode de la classe depuis une autre méthode:. Faites en sorte de configurer votre éditeur favori de façon à écrire 4 espaces lorsque vous tapez sur la touche Tab. On peut également comparer ce modèle aux différentes protéines:. On les appelle docstrings. Nous avons déjà croisé ce concept à plusieurs reprises.

Patrick Fuchs et Pierre Poulain prénom [point] nom [arobase] univ-paris-diderot [point] fr. Ce cours est basé sur la version 3 de Python, version recommandée par la communauté scientifique. Merci également à tous les contributeurs, occasionels ou réguliers: Enfin, merci à vous tous, les curieux de Python, qui avez été nombreux à nous envoyer des retours sur ce cours, à nous suggérer des améliorations et à nous signaler des coquilles.

De nombreuses personnes nous ont aussi demandé les corrections des exercices. Pour apprendre la programmation Python, il va falloir que vous pratiquiez et pour cela il est préférable que Python soit installé sur votre ordinateur. À tout fin utile, on rappelle néanmoins que Microsoft WordWordPad et LibreOffice Writer ne sont pas des éditeurs de texte, ce sont des traitements de texte qui ne 34.2 pas et ne doivent pas être utilisés pour écrire du code informatique.

python – Comment installer PyGame sur Python ?

La première version publique 3.4.2 ce langage a été publiée en La dernière version de Python est la version 3. Plus précisément, la version 3. Ce cours est basé sur Python 3. Dans cet ouvrage, les commandes, les instructions Python, les résultats et les contenus de fichiers sont indiquées sous cette forme pour les éléments ponctuels ou.

Pour ces derniers, le numéro à gauche indique le numéro de pythln ligne et sera utilisé pour faire référence à une instruction particulière. Par ailleurs, dans le cas de programmes, de contenus de fichiers ou de résultats trop longs pour être inclus dans leur intégralité, la notation [ Pour vous en rendre compte, ouvrez un shellpuis lancez la commande:.

Vous devriez obtenir quelque chose de ce style pour Windows:. Python a exécuté la commande directement et a affiché le texte Pythoj world! En résumé, voici ce qui a du apparaître sur votre écran:. Il existe de nombreux autres langages interprétés tels que Perl ou R. Gardez bien en mémoire cette propriété de Python qui pourra 3.2 vous faire gagner un temps précieux! Ensuite enregistrez votre fichier sous le nom test. Pour exécuter votre script, ouvrez un shell et entrez la commande python test.

Vous devriez obtenir un résultat similaire:. Les commentaires doivent expliquer votre code dans pyhhon langage humain.

En programmation, il est courant de répéter un certain nombre de choses avec les boucles, voir le chapitre 5 Boucles et comparaisons ou de faire des choix avec les tests, voir le chapitre 6 Tests. Par exemple, on souhaite répéter 10 fois 3 instructions différentes, les unes à la suite des autres.

  TÉLÉCHARGER ZOPANAGE NAMANA MP3 GRATUIT

python 3.4.2

Cette instruction se termine par le symbole: Lignes 2 à 4. Si tout cela semble un peu complexe, ne vous inquiétez pas. Vous allez comprendre tous ces détails, et surtout les acquérir, chapitre après chapitre. Ce cours est basé sur la version 3 de Python, qui est maintenant devenu un standard. Python 3 est donc la version à utiliser. Le chapitre 21 Remarques complémentaires vous apportera plus de précisions.

Une variable est une zone de la mémoire dans laquelle une valeur est stockée. Dans cet exemple, nous avons déclaré, puis initialisé la variable x avec la valeur 2. Dans certains autres langages, il faut coder ces différentes étapes une par une en C par exemple. Les trois types principaux dont nous aurons besoin dans un premier temps sont les entiers integer ou intles réels float et les chaînes de caractères string ou str.

Vous remarquez que Python reconnaît certains types de variable automatiquement entier, réel. Les quatre opérations de base se font de manière simple sur les types numériques nombres entiers et réels:.

OVH Community

Remarquez toutefois que si vous mélangez les types entiers et réels, le résultat est renvoyé comme un réel car ce type est plus général. On appelle ce comportement redéfinition des opérateurs. Nous serons amenés à revoir cette notion dans le chapitre 18 sur les classes. Faites bien attention, car pour Python, la valeur 2 nombre entier est différente de 2. Nous verrons plus tard ce que signifie le mot class. En Python, rien de plus simple avec les fonctions intfloat et str.

Pour vous en convaincre, regardez ces exemples:. On verra au chapitre 7 sur les fichiers que ces conversions sont essentielles. Pour en savoir plus sur ce point, vous pouvez consulter la section Pour aller plus loin.

Nous avons vu dans ce chapitre la notion de variable qui est commune à tous les langages de programmation.

python 3.4.2

Toutefois, Python est un langage dit orienté objetil se peut que dans la suite du cours nous employions ce mot objet pour désigner une variable. Par exemple variable de type entier sera équivalent à un objet de type entier. Nous verrons ce que 34.2 mot ptyhon signifie réellement plus tard tout comme le mot class. Par ailleurs, nous puthon rencontré plusieurs fois pthon fonctions dans ce chapitre, avec type xint xfloat x et str x.

Dans le chapitre 1 nous avons également vu la fonction print. En Python la syntaxe générale est 34.2. Si ces notions vous font peur, ne vous inquiétez pas, au fur et à mesure que vous avancerez dans le cours tout deviendra limpide. Python a donc écrit la phrase en remplaçant les variables x et nom par leur contenu. Vous pouvez noter également que pour écrire plusieurs blocs de texte sur une seule ligne, nous avons utilisé le séparateuravec la fonction print. Par conséquent, si vous voulez mettre un seul espace entre chaque bloc, vous pouvez retirer ceux de vos chaînes de caractères:.

Notez enfin que le formatage avec. Cette syntaxe est pratique lorsque vous voulez taper une commande longue. Dans la portion de code suivant, le caractère ; sert de séparateur entre les instructions sur une même ligne:. Ce formatage est également possible sur des chaînes de caractères, notées s comme string:.

  TÉLÉCHARGER SONNERIE KOODO

Remarquez que le séparateur décimal. Enfin, si on veut écrire des accolades litérales et utiliser la méthode format en même temps, il faudra doubler les accolades pour échapper au formatage. Comme indiqué ci-dessus, la méthode. La syntaxe est légèrement différente. Revenons quelques instants sur la notion de méthode abordée dans ce chapitre avec. En Python, on peut 3.4. considérer chaque variable comme un objet sur lequel on peut appliquer des méthodes.

La syntaxe générale est du type objet. La méthode renvoie pytnon nouvelle chaîne de caractères avec le bon formatage. Ecrivez la même chose dans un script test. Exécutez ce script en tapant python3 test. Générez une chaîne de caractères représentant un oligonucléotide polyA AAAA… de 20 bases de longueurs, sans taper littéralement toutes les bases.

python 3.4.2

Dans pythob script propGC. On souhaite que le programme affiche la sortie suivante:. Une liste est une structure de données qui contient une série de valeurs. Python autorise la pythn de liste contenant des valeurs de type différent par exemple entier et chaîne de caractèresce qui leur confère une grande flexibilité. En voici quelques exemples:. Ce numéro est appelé indice ou index de la liste.

Vous pouvez aussi utiliser la méthode. Nous reverrons en détail la méthode. Les indices négatifs reviennent à compter à partir de la fin. Un autre avantage des listes est la possibilité de sélectionner une partie en utilisant un indiçage construit sur le modèle [m: On peut aussi préciser le pas en ajoutant un: La commande list range 10 a généré une liste contenant tous les nombres entiers de 0 inclus à 10 exclu.

Les arguments entre crochets sont optionnels. Enfin, prenez garde aux arguments optionnels par défaut 0 pour début et 1 pour 34.2.

Ici la liste est vide car Python a pris la valeur du pas par défaut qui est de 1. Python génère ainsi une liste vide. Pour éviter ça, il faudra absolument préciser le pas de -1 pour les listes décroissantes:. Cette fonctionnalité peut être parfois très pratique. Créez 4 listes hiverprintempsete et automne contenant les mois correspondants à ces saisons.

Créez ensuite une liste saisons contenant les sous-listes hiverprintempsete et automne. Affichez la table des 9 en une seule commande avec les instructions range et list. Avec Python, répondez à la question suivante pythpn une seule commande.

En programmation, on est souvent amené à répéter plusieurs fois une instruction. Incontournables à tout langage de programmation, les boucles vont nous aider à réaliser cette tâche de manière compacte.

Pour remédier à cela, il faut utiliser les boucles.